Output 3c66fab929ea1f5b06d15eb5c09fc87c2b3048fb118936d59d7d7ea4fffc1090:20

value
246784
script pubkey
OP_0 OP_PUSHBYTES_20 6447ef3b28f73fd485c70b66064f8371b52078a3
address
bc1qv3r77weg7ulafpw8pdnqvnurwx6jq79rr9h9ty
transaction
3c66fab929ea1f5b06d15eb5c09fc87c2b3048fb118936d59d7d7ea4fffc1090
confirmations
133178
spent
true